Lois Helen Pinson, 93, passed away at her San Marcos home after a brief illness on August 23, 2023 in San Marcos, Ca. Lois had loving support for her, and her family from Woodland Borden Care. We thank them for their exemplary kindness.
Lois was born to Ernest and Mattie Pinson on May 3,1930 in Springfield Tennessee.
Lois was the third of four children. Mildred, Cala June and her brother Earnest, all who have preceded her in death.
Lois moved with her family to New Orleans in Sept of 1934. She attended elementary school there before moving to Mississippi, where her father was a pastor in several area Baptist churches.
Clarke College, is where she received her Bachelor’s degree. Lois liked new experiences and moving. That’s how Texas ended up calling her name. Lois went to University of Houston receiving her Master’s degree.
Lois was a dedicated and devoted teacher and counselor in public schools. Starting in Arkansas, moved back to Texas, before living in San Diego and retiring from teaching at Wangenheim Middle School.
Lois saw the sky and started walking. She walked miles every day with her best friend a Cavalier King Charles Spaniel dog called Chuck. When that little dog was too old to keep up, Lois purchased a radio flyer red wagon, complete with side boards, and towed that little guy along with her. She said she noticed the men loved the silkiness of Chucks ears.
Lois was renowned for her love of sweets, which she enjoyed with uncurbed enthusiasm Three desert Lois was our nickname for her.
Lois will be deeply missed. We celebrate a life well lived. Lois Pinson a loyal friend, a dedicated teacher, a gracious soul, will forever live in our hearts.
